Summary |
A corrupt millionaire junk dealer, embarrassed by his girlfriend's lack of social sophistication, arranges to have her trained in a crash course in "culture." He is surprised and outraged when after becoming aware of her role as pawn in his crooked business deals, she refuses to cooperate. |
Awards |
Nominated for Academy Awards: Best Picture, Best Actress (Judy Holliday, winner), Best Director, Best Screenplay and Best Costume Design. |
